Norwich president moves into a dorm room. Media spotlight ensues.


March 08, 2021
New York Times, Anderson Cooper’s ‘Full Circle’ show highlight how Norwich coped with COVID-19 in-room quarantine
Have you heard the story about the Norwich University leader who moved into a student dorm in a COVID-19 pandemic show of solidarity? Sure you have. And now, thanks to a pair of national media appearances last week, America has, too.
President Mark C. Anarumo’s move into Wilson Hall, a Corps of Cadets barracks, on Jan. 29 began as an internal story, shared by the president himself in brief update videos.
The story then spread statewide. Dana Casullo and Burlington, Vermont, television station WVNY-TV/WFFF-TV, Channel 22/44, were first to report it off campus, with a story Feb. 3. The Associated Press followed with a story Feb. 4; Burlington, Vermont’s WPTZ-TV, Channel 5, followed with a report Feb. 5.

A college president worried of the risks of dorm isolation. So he moved in.


March 5, 2021
NORTHFIELD, Vt. — Derek Furtado, a sophomore at Norwich University, had just stepped out of the shower in his dormitory and was shaving, a towel wrapped around his waist, when he looked to his left and saw the figure of a man in military uniform.
“That was when my heart sunk,” recalled Furtado, a cadet who plans to commission into the Coast Guard. He pulled himself together, stood at attention and said, “Good morning, sir!” The circumstances were not ideal. “He has two stars on his chest,” Furtado said. “I’m in a towel.”
But he would have to get used to it, because it turned out that Col. Mark C. Anarumo, the university’s president, was his new hallmate.

The Checkup for Feb. 4: Two deaths, 165 new cases of COVID-19 in Vermont


THE NUMBERS
Two Vermonters died of COVID-19 over the past day, the state Department of Health reported Thursday. The death toll is now 181.
The department reported 165 new cases of COVID-19 on Thursday. The reported total of 12,503 is 174 higher than the total reported Wednesday. The department did not explain the discrepancy.
Bennington County continues to have the highest rate of COVID-19 among Vermont counties, at 321.9 cases per 10,000 residents since the beginning of the pandemic. Chittenden County is second, at 253.9, while the rate in Windham County is 190.4.
Bennington County has reported 309 new cases over the past two weeks, and Windham County has reported 66. Chittenden County, Vermont’s largest county, has had 471 over the same period.
